The Role of Fire Damage Restoration Specialists 

Fire damage restoration specialists are trained to respond quickly after a fire. Their goal is to prevent further deterioration and start the recovery process as soon as the area is deemed safe. 

What They Do: 

  • Damage Assessment: Inspect and document all affected areas.ย 
  • Smoke & Soot Removal: Eliminate harmful residues that cause long-term damage.ย 
  • Structural Repairs: Rebuild damaged walls, floors, and ceilings.ย 
  • Odor Elimination: Use advanced deodorizing techniques to neutralize smoke smells.ย 
  • Safety Checks: Ensure electrical, plumbing, and structural systems are safe.ย

Why Quick Response Matters 

Every hour counts after a fire. Soot and smoke begin corroding surfaces within minutes, and water from firefighting efforts can seep into walls and flooring. Fire damage restoration specialists work within the first 24โ€“48 hours to minimize loss and health risks. According to FEMA, immediate intervention can reduce total restoration costs by up to 40%. 

Fire Cleanup Experts: The Frontline Heroes 

Fire cleanup experts are different from general contractorsโ€”they use specialized tools and methods to address post-fire conditions: 

  • HEPA vacuums to trap fine smoke particlesย 
  • Thermal fogging to eliminate smoke odorย 
  • Industrial-grade dehumidifiers to remove moistureย 
  • Ant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and bacteriaย 

They also follow OSHA safety guidelines to protect your family from toxic residue during cleanup. 

Water Damage: The Unseen Enemy After Fire 

When firefighters extinguish a blaze, they often leave behind extensive water damage. This moisture, if not addressed immediately, leads to: 

  • Warped woodย 
  • Mold growthย 
  • Electrical hazardsย 
  • Damage to insulation and drywallย 

Restoration professionals integrate water damage recovery with fire services, using moisture detection tools and drying systems to prevent future structural issues. 

Sewage Backup Risks After a Fire 

In some severe fire events, especially in older or flood-prone buildings, plumbing can be compromised. The result? Sewage backups, which pose serious health risks due to: 

  • Bacterial exposureย 
  • Airborne contaminationย 
  • Unsanitary conditions that delay restorationย 

Fire cleanup experts often partner with water restoration crews to manage biohazard cleanup and ensure sanitation. 

Signs You Need a Fire Restoration Specialist 

If you notice any of the following, contact a specialist immediately: 

  • Strong smoke or chemical odor lingering indoorsย 
  • Black streaks on ceilings or wallsย 
  • Cracked drywall or bubbling paintย 
  • Damp spots or signs of moldย 
  • Warped flooringย 

These are signs of hidden damage that can worsen over time if not addressed by professionals. 

What to Expect During the Restoration Process 

  1. Emergency Contact & Inspectionย 
  2. Immediate Board-Up & Roof Tarpingย 
  3. Water Removal & Dryingย 
  4. Soot & Smoke Removalย 
  5. Cleaning & Sanitizationย 
  6. Restoration & Repairsย

How to Choose the Right Fire Damage Restoration Specialists 

When selecting a restoration company, look for: 

  • IICRC Certificationย 
  • 24/7 Emergency Servicesย 
  • Transparent Pricing & Estimatesย 
  • Experience with Insurance Claimsย 
  • Positive Reviews & Local Referencesย
